ALMAGRO URRUTIA, Zoraya; SAEZ CARRIERA, Rolando; SANCHEZ, Clara and LEMUS CRUZ, Leticia María. A case of overdenture. Rev Cubana Estomatol [online]. 2009, vol.46, n.1, pp. 0-0. ISSN 1561-297X.
Implantation is a science with a rapid development in past years offering possibility of to solve problems of people. A continue scientific and technical research made oral implantation be every day more accepted, since some work decades have turn implants into the best present choice. Aim of present paper is to describe the different types of prosthetic rehabilitation on implants in total edentulous which allow showing some of implantation possibilities in solving of retention, support, and stability problems in total edentulous patients with much reabsorbed edges, very difficult to restore by means of conventional techniques. We conclude that overdentures retained by bars and spheres, as well as implant- supported fixed bridges, are ideals to solve these problems, offering also comfort, functional qualities and aesthetics.
Keywords : Supported implant; retention; support and stability.
